WebRotate towel as it picks up stain. Sponge with a commercial cleaner’ or waterless hand cleaner. Rinse with water. Apply detergent to stain. Launder, using hot water and bleach, chlorine type if safe for fabric. If dye stain remains from wax, sponge it with alcohol diluted with 2 parts water. Rinse with water. WebUsing Rubbing Alcohol to Remove Candle Wax Dye Stain. Apply a small amount of rubbing alcohol to a clean towel and dab the stain. If the towel turns the color of the dye, the alcohol is working to remove the stain. Continue dabbing the stain until it has been completely removed. Do not rub as this will further set and spread the dye stain.

WebSep 25, 2024 · Method 1: Place your tablecloth over an old towel. Use a blunt knife or spatula to scrape off as much of the wax as possible. Be careful not to damage the fabric of your tablecloth. Put the tablecloth in the freezer for 30 minutes. Remove the tablecloth from the freezer and gently peel off the remaining wax. ocnモバイル 子供 制限

WebFeb 23, 2024 · Step 1: Use the Dryer to Soften the Wax. Turn the blow dryer on, starting with the lowest heat and airflow settings, and direct it at the spill, holding it about an inch away from the wax. Adjust the distance to the wax, as well as the heat and airflow settings, as needed to ensure that the dryer melts the wax.

WebStep 1. Remove any traces of the candle wax itself before focusing on the oil stain. The best way to do this is to fold the fabric and place it in the freezer overnight. The chill of the freezer will harden any attached candle wax making it easy to remove. Video of the Day.

WebSep 12, 2024 · This method requires a bit of warm water and a bar of (vegan) Gall soap. Simply blot the stain with warm water and rub the Gall soap on the wax stain. Let the stain sit for a few minutes, and then blot it with a dry rag. Finally, either air dry it, or if pressed for time, use a hairdryer. Try this: Take an ice cube and freeze the wax, scraping off as much as you can. Then take a paper towel, put it over the remaining wax stain, press a warm iron over the paper towel, the rest should melt into the paper towel. Wash as usual, putting some shout on the stain. ocnモバイル 子供 フィルタリング
